What are the responsibilities and job description for the Senior Business Intelligence & Clinical Info Analyst, Days, Hybrid (KY/IN Residents Only) position at Norton Healthcare?
Responsibilities
The Senior Business Intelligence & Clinical Info Analyst works in Norton Healthcare’s (NHC’s) system office as part of a team of statisticians and data analysts supporting business requirements to develop methodologies and programs to extract structured and unstructured data elements into a Data Warehouse, enabling statistical analysis of processes and outcome measures. This includes, but is not limited to, designing, writing and conducting complex statistical analyses to measure and develop recommendations for improvement, serving as an internal expert and consultant on statistical and computer techniques related to data capture and transformation and providing timely, accurate and useful analytical datasets for use in internal and external reporting.
